Olympic hopeful Cavendish wins fourth stage of the Giro d'Italia
Britain's Mark Cavendish won the fourth stage of the Giro d'Italia in a sprint finish in Catanzaro. Cavendish finished the 183km stage in four hours, 49 minutes and nine seconds to secure his first-ever Giro win.

Earnshaw set to seal a move to Forest
Robert Earnshaw will discuss a move to Nottingham Forest after Derby County accepted a bid from the City Ground club. Paul Jewell confirmed on Sunday evening that an offer had been accepted for Earnshaw and that was why he was left out of the squad to face Reading.

Premier League duo sign on for QPR
Fresh on the heels of sacking manager Luigi di Canio, Queens Park Rangers have signed two Premier League players in a bid to improve on their 14th place achieved in the Championship this season. Spurs goalkeeper Radek Cerny and Newcastle defender Peter Ramage have signed on at Loftus Road.

Watford captain has red card rescinded for play-off
Aidy Boothroyd has had a boost ahead of Watford's crucial Chgampionship play-off second leg: his captain John Eustace has had his red card from the first leg rescinded, and will be available for Wednesday's game at the KC Stadium.

Haughton extends Saracens deal
Richard Haughton, Saracens' winger or full-back, has put pen to paper on a new two-year deal at the north London club. The 27-year-old has been rewarded for a superb season, in which he scored 11 times.

Deacon to miss Premiership semi and New Zealand tour
England and Leicester second row Louis Deacon has been ruled out of Martin Johnson's tour squad to New Zealand - due to be named on Tuesday morning - and will miss the remainder of the domestic season, as he will not recover from a back injury in time.

James shines as Celtics continue away slump LeBron James was the star for Cleveland Cavaliers as they defeated the Boston Celtics 88-77 to tie the best-of-seven series 2-2 on Monday. James hit 21 points and laid on 13 assists for the home team, who gave away just 12 points in the final quarter. 13 May 2008, 9:09 AM

Rampant Wigan cruise past Whitehaven
Trent Barrett claimed a hat-trick as Wigan cruised into the quarter-finals of the Challenge Cup after crushing Division One side Whitehaven 106-8 at the JJB Stadium.
